Volunteer First Responders for Optimizing Management of Mass Casualty Incidents.
Rapid response to a trauma incident is vital for saving lives. However, in a mass casualty incident (MCI), there may not be enough resources (first responders and equipment) to adequately triage, prepare, and evacuate every injured person. To address this deficit, a Volunteer First Responder (VFR) program was established. ⋯ The VFR program provides an important and effective life-saving resource to supplement emergency first response. Given the known importance of rapid response to trauma, VFRs likely contribute to reduced trauma mortality, although further research is needed in order to examine this question specifically. Primary Care Medical Practices: Are Community Health Care Providers Ready for Disasters?
This study seeks to determine the capacity of community primary care practices to meet the needs of patients during public health emergencies and to identify the barriers and resources necessary to participate in a coordinated response with public safety agencies. ⋯ Community-based primary care practices can be useful partners during public health emergencies. Efforts to promote continuity of operations planning, improved coordination with government and community partners, as well as preparedness for patients with special health care needs, would augment their capabilities and contribute to community resilience. The Infectious Disease Network (IDN): Development and Use for Evaluation of Potential Ebola Cases in Georgia.
In response to the 2014 Ebola virus disease (EVD) outbreak in West Africa, the Georgia Department of Public Health developed the Infectious Disease Network (IDN) based on an EVD preparedness needs assessment of hospitals and Emergency Medical Services (EMS) providers. The network consists of 12 hospitals and 16 EMS providers with staff specially trained to provide a coordinated response and utilize appropriate personal protective equipment (PPE) for the transport or treatment of a suspected or confirmed serious communicable disease patient. ⋯ Since March 2015, the IDN has been used to transport, treat, and/or evaluate suspected or confirmed serious communicable disease cases while ensuring health care worker safety. Integrated infectious disease response systems among hospitals and EMS providers are critical to ensuring health care worker safety, and preventing or mitigating a serious communicable disease outbreak. The General Public's Attitudes and Beliefs Regarding Resource Management, Collaboration, and Community Assistance Centers During Disasters.
The key to resilience after disasters is the provision of coordinated care and resource distribution to the affected community. Past research indicates that the general public lacks an understanding regarding agencies' roles and responsibilities during disaster response.Study ObjectivesThis study's purpose was to explore the general public's beliefs regarding agencies or organizations' responsibilities related to resource management during disasters. In addition, the public's attitudes towards the management and use of community disaster assistance centers were explored. ⋯ The general public prefers that local agencies and leaders manage disaster response, and they expect collaboration among response agencies. Community assistance centers need to be located close to those in need, and be managed by agencies trusted by the general public. (Disaster Med Public Health Preparedness. 2018;12:446-449).

Developing a Hospital Disaster Preparedness Plan for Mass Casualty Incidents: Lessons Learned From the Downtown Beirut Bombing.
Mass casualty incidents (MCIs) are becoming more frequent worldwide, especially in the Middle East where violence in Syria has spilled over to many neighboring countries. Lebanon lacks a coordinated prehospital response system to deal with MCIs; therefore, hospital preparedness plans are essential to deal with the surge of casualties. This report describes our experience in dealing with an MCI involving a car bomb in an urban area of downtown Beirut, Lebanon. ⋯ Casualties' arrival to our emergency department (ED), the performance of our hospital staff during the event, communication, and the coordination of resources, in addition to the response of the different departments, were examined. In dealing with MCIs, hospital plans should focus on triage area, patient registration and tracking, communication, resource coordination, essential staff functions, as well as on security issues and crowd control. Hospitals in other countries that lack a coordinated prehospital disaster response system can use the principles described here to improve their hospital's resilience and response to MCIs.
